Keurig Dr Pepper Associate Scientist in Burlington, Massachusetts

The Associate Sensory Scientist will use his/her knowledge of sensory science to deliver research for innovation and renovation initiatives, as well as participate in the development of sensory and consumer capabilities. The individual will interact extensively with Product Development, Marketing, Sales, Quality, Regulatory, Engineering, Manufacturing Operations, and External Customers to deliver business objectives.

The Associate Sensory Scientist will be responsible for leading an internal descriptive panel and independently analyzing the data and presenting findings to various audiences The Associate Sensory Scientist will support to design the research plan, determine appropriate sensory and consumer research methodologies, coordinate tests, analyze and interpret experimental data and provide technical recommendations, reporting results orally and in written documentation in a timely manner. He/she will ensure products are well optimized and deliver on the targeted key parameters.

Position Accountabilities

  • Lead an internal Descriptive Analysis panel - This includes all aspects of panel management including but not limited to descriptive language development, training, calibrating panel members, providing instructive feedback to the panel in general and to individuals, analyzing data, and presenting results to cross functional team

  • With support from team, delivers sensory research within R&D, meeting business objectives, driving standards, consistency and ensuring excellence in research.

  • Provides feedback to appropriate cross functional team members and customers; reports findings and communicates next steps to team members with manager supervision. Actively participates in project team meetings as required and ensures delivery of commitments and project milestones.

  • Independently deliver sensory experiments/tasks.

  • Creates research plans to fit overall business priorities and objectives, applies design of experiments to sensory tests, and interprets statistical analysis of the results of sensory test with manager or mentor’s guidance.

  • Generates high quality, robust, compliant data, and reports. Supports improvement of standardized sensory practices, protocols, and processes across various functions of the organization. Performs comprehensive, sophisticated, and critical evaluation of own data and data from other scientists.

  • Works closely with other Sensory Scientists and works effectively with various functions of R&D (Ingredients, Nutrition, Regulatory, Flavor Technology, Chemistry, Process Engineering, and Technical Services)

  • Manages projects within a cross-functional team consisting of members across various departments of KDP (R&D, Marketing, Supply Chain, Sales)

  • Communicates clearly and concisely to audiences with a wide range of understanding of Sensory Science.
